The MAX4526ESA from Maxim Integrated is a precision, dual, SPST (Single Pole Single Throw) analog switch that offers low-voltage operation with single-supply voltages from +1.8V to +5.5V. This versatile component is designed to be a high-performance solution for multiplexing and signal routing applications in various electronic systems.
Key Features
- Low Voltage Operation: Operates from a single +1.8V to +5.5V supply, making it ideal for portable and battery-powered applications.
- Low On-Resistance: Features low on-resistance (Ron) of 100Ω max, ensuring minimal signal distortion and power loss.
- High Switching Speed: Fast switching speeds (tON = 120ns, tOFF = 80ns) enable efficient signal processing and rapid response times in critical applications.
- Low Power Consumption: Consumes minimal power with a quiescent current of only 1µA max, which is advantageous for power-sensitive designs.
- ESD Protection: Equipped with ESD protection diodes on all terminals, it can withstand ESD events, enhancing the durability and reliability of the component.
- Single/Dual Supply Operation: Can be operated with a single positive supply or with dual supplies for greater design flexibility.
- Wide Operating Temperature Range: Suitable for commercial applications with an operating temperature range of -40°C to +85°C.
